Summary: The Biology Subject Matter Expert (AI Training) role involves evaluating and enhancing AI systems focused on advanced biological content. Candidates will design biology-related questions, assess AI responses, and collaborate with researchers to improve AI quality. This position offers the flexibility of remote work and the opportunity to contribute to significant advancements in scientific AI. Ideal candidates should possess a strong background in biology and excellent communication skills.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Design challenging biology questions and problems to rigorously test AI performance
  • Develop clear, step-by-step solutions with well-structured scientific reasoning
  • Evaluate AI-generated responses for accuracy, logical soundness, and depth of understanding
  • Identify gaps or errors in AI reasoning across undergraduate to Masters-level biology topics
  • Collaborate with researchers to refine benchmarks and improve AI quality
  • Work independently and asynchronously on your own schedule

Key Skills:

  • Currently pursuing or have completed a Masters degree in Biology, Biotechnology, Biochemistry, or a closely related field
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ills across advanced biology domains
  • Able to communicate complex scientific concepts clearly and precisely in writing
  • Detail-oriented with a commitment to scientific accuracy
  • Self-motivated and comfortable working independently
  • No prior AI experience required
  • Experience in data annotation, data quality assessment, or evaluation workflows (nice to have)
  • Background in molecular biology, genetics, physiology, ecology, or related specializations (nice to have)
  • Familiarity with how large language models work (nice to have)

Salary (Rate): £28.00 hourly
